Austria has fallen silent for a minute and people are laying candles in the city of Graz in memory of the 10 people killed in a school shooting that shocked the country.
Authorities say a former student opened fire at a school, fatally wounding 10 people and injuring many others before taking his own life.
The community is now mourning the loss of young lives. People left flowers and candles outside the school in memory of the victims. Austrian leaders declared three days of national mourning.
